Avatar billede tobrukDk Novice
13. juli 2012 - 12:18 Der er 1 løsning

problemer med godkende del

hej

jeg arbejder lige nu på at bruger kan blive godkendt til at log ind på siden..

min kode det er sådan at det ser sådan her ud lige nu og her men håber dog at jeg kan få klart det til at den gå efter rank,

<div class="top_left_box">
    <div class="shine"></div>
    <div class="head">Log ind</div>
    <div class="text">
        <form action="http://www.xxx.dk/godkendt/" method="post">
        <p>Brugernavn</p>
        <input type="text" name="brugernavn_1" placeholder="Brugernavn">
        <p>Password</p>
        <input type="password" name="password" placeholder="Password">
        <input type="submit" value="Log ind" class="css3button">
        </form>
    </div>
</div>


så bliver den sendt videre til den her file som frem viser/godkende bruger til om man må log ind eller ej


<?php
include ("inc/db/db.php");
session_start();
     
    if($stmt = $mysqli->prepare("SELECT id_bruger, Brugernavn, djnavn, rank FROM `bruger_infomation` WHERE `Brugernavn` = ? && `password` = ?"))
{
    $stmt->bind_param('ss', $Brugernavn, $password);
    $Brugernavn = $_POST['brugernavn_1'];
    $password = sha1($_POST['password']);
    $stmt->execute();
    $stmt->store_result();
    $stmt->bind_result($id_bruger, $Brugernavn, $djnavn, $rank);
    $stmt->fetch();
    $count_res = $stmt->num_rows;
    $stmt->close();

    if($count_res > 0) {
        $_SESSION["logged_in"] = true;
        $_SESSION["user_id"] = $id_bruger;
        $_SESSION["Brugernavn"] = $Brugernavn;
        $_SESSION["djnavn"] = $djnavn;
        $_SESSION["rank"] = $rank;
        if($rank == 0)
        {
            header('Location: http://www.example.com/');
            exit();
        }
        if($rank == 1)
        {
            header('Location: http://www.example.com/');
            exit();
        }
        if($rank >= 2)
        {
            header('Location: http://www.example.com/');
            exit();
        }
    }
    else {
        header('Location: http://www.xxx.dk/');
        exit();
    }
}
?>


du i kan se noget af min database her ;

http://jesperbok.dk/database.png
Avatar billede tobrukDk Novice
13. juli 2012 - 21:20 #1
Problem er klart..
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ester